Technical Field

[0001] This invention relates to the field of gear processing technology, and in particular to a multi-path optically stable backlash-eliminating gear device and method. Background Technology

[0002] During the operation of high-precision equipment, the components within the transmission system need to work closely together to ensure the normal operation of the equipment. However, during the meshing motion of gears, errors in machining accuracy or wear during the motion can cause gaps to form on both sides of the gear teeth when they mesh, resulting in errors in transmission accuracy and affecting transmission efficiency.

[0003] Based on this, the present invention provides a multi-path optically stabilized backlash-eliminating gear device and method. Summary of the Invention

[0012] A method for machining multi-path optically stable backlash-free gears, employing the aforementioned machining apparatus, includes the following specific steps:

[0013] S1: Place the gear to be processed on top of the clamping base and clamp the gear through the transmission clamping plate;

[0014] S2: Start the fifth motor to adjust the position and angle of the detection mechanism and the cutting mechanism, so that the light signal transmitter is aligned with the gear teeth to detect the shape and angle of the gear teeth;

[0015] S3: Start the cutting motor to process the tooth groove through the cutting plate, and process the bottom of the tooth groove into an arc-shaped groove;

[0016] S4: Start the third motor to adjust the position of the heating spray gun and cooling nozzle to quench the processed gear.

[0017] The beneficial effects of this invention compared with the prior art are: (1) By processing grooves at the bottom of the tooth groove, this invention can prevent the tooth tip from contacting the bottom of the tooth groove when the gear meshes, so that the two sides of the teeth between the two gears can contact each other, eliminating the gap between the teeth and increasing the accuracy of gear transmission; (2) This invention can detect the shape of the teeth more accurately through the optical signal transmitter, ensuring the accuracy of the gear after processing; (3) This invention can quench the processed gear through the transmission clamp and heating spray gun, improving the wear resistance of the processed gear. Detailed Implementation

[0026] The technical solution provided by the present invention will be further described below with reference to the accompanying drawings and specific implementation methods.

[0027] like Figures 1 to 7 As shown, a multi-channel optically stabilized backlash-eliminating gear device includes an equipment support 1 comprising a processing base 102. A processing bracket 101 is fixedly mounted on the top of the processing base 102. A first sliding support plate 113 and a second sliding support plate 114 are slidably mounted laterally at the front and rear ends of the processing bracket 101, respectively. An extension rod and a sliding groove are fixedly installed in the first sliding support plate 113 and the second sliding support plate 114, and they slide and cooperate with each other. A detection mechanism 2 and a cutting mechanism 3 are rotatably mounted in the first sliding support plate 113 at both ends, respectively. The detection mechanism 2 includes a first telescopic base 203. A light signal transmitter 202 is fixedly mounted on the top of the first telescopic base 203. A laser receiver 201 is fixedly mounted on the top of the first telescopic base 203 via a telescopic rod. The light signal transmitter 202 and the laser receiver 201 cooperate to detect the shape of the gear and the tilt angle of the gear teeth. The light signal is transmitted through the laser. The emitter 202 controls the focusing range of multiple laser beams and detects the position and number of received laser beams from the laser receiver 201 to detect the gear specifications. A first fixed ring 204 is fixedly installed on the first telescopic base 203. The inner ring of the first fixed ring 204 has gear patterns, and multiple rollers are rotatably installed on the outer ring of the first fixed ring 204. An annular groove is provided in the first sliding support plate 113, and the first fixed ring 204 rotates with the annular groove. A fourth motor 115 is fixedly installed in the first sliding support plate 113, and a gear is fixedly installed on the fourth motor 115. The gear on the fourth motor 115 meshes with the gear patterns on the inner ring of the first fixed ring 204. By controlling the rotation of the first motor 105, the first fixed ring 204 is driven to rotate in the first sliding support plate 113, adjusting the detection angle of the laser receiver 201 and the light signal emitter 202 to detect the tooth shape of the helical gear.

[0028] like Figures 1 to 7 As shown, the cutting mechanism 3 includes a second telescopic base 302. A cutting motor 301 is fixedly installed on the top of the second telescopic base 302. A cutting plate 304 is rotatably installed on the front end of the cutting motor 301. The cutting plate 304 is used to process the tooth groove of the gear. The bottom of the tooth groove is processed into a concave arc shape so that when the gear meshes with each other, there will be no gap on both sides of the tooth due to contact between the tooth and the bottom of the tooth groove, which would affect the accuracy of the gear transmission.

[0034] Working principle: When backlash elimination is required on a gear, the gear to be processed is first placed on the surface of the clamping base 401. According to the size of the gear, the adjusting screw 404 is rotated to drive the adjusting ring 405 to slide, and the clamping claw 402 is driven to slide on the surface of the clamping base 401 through the transmission rod 403. The support position of the clamping claw 402 is adjusted. Then, the first motor 105 is started to drive the clamping threaded rod 104 to rotate and adjust the height of the clamping bracket 103. At this time, the transmission clamping plate 108 contacts the top of the gear, and the second motor 106 is started to drive the transmission clamping plate 108 to rotate, and the gear is driven to rotate through the transmission clamping plate 108.

[0035] Then, the fifth motor 116 is started to drive the adjusting threaded rod 111 to rotate, synchronously adjusting the processing and detection position and tilt angle of the detection mechanism 2 and the cutting mechanism 3. Then, the shape and angle of the gear teeth are detected by the laser receiver 201 and the light signal transmitter 202. The fourth motor 115 is started to drive the detection mechanism 2 and the cutting mechanism 3 to rotate synchronously, changing the processing angle. The cutting motor 301 is started to drive the cutting plate 304 to rotate, and the tooth groove is processed.

[0036] During the processing, the processed gear groove is heated by the heating spray gun 109 and quenched by the cooling spray head 110 to increase the wear resistance of the treated gear.
